Agar-gel Precipitin-inhibition Technique for C-reactive Protein Determinations. I. Preliminary Evaluation of Technique.

An application of the agargel precipitin-inhibition technique of Ray and Kadull detects the C-reactive protein present in the acute-phase human sera. The sensitivity of this procedure is compared with the capillary tube-precipitin method of Selman and Halpern.

Agar-gel precipitin-inhibition technique for histoplasmosis antibody determinations.
The agar-gel precipitin-inhibition technique has been modified to detect antibodies of Histoplasma capsulatum in sera from human clinical cases and experimental animals infected with this organism. An application of the agar-gel precipitin-inhibition technique we described previously can be used to detect plague antibodies in human and animal sera after a series of plague vaccine inoculations or after exposure to Pasteurella pestis. متن کاملSoluble antigens for immunofluorescence detection of Histoplasma capsulatum antibodies.
Soluble antigens from Histoplasma capsulatum in the mycelial and yeast phase were purified by gel filtration, fixed onto paper discs, and employed in an indirect immunofluorescence procedure to detect antibody in sera from individuals infected with H. capsulatum. متن کاملNew Approaches for the Laboratory Recognition of M Types of Group a Streptococci
The successful classification of Group A streptococci by the capillary precipitin technique requires a complete series of M type antisera which are sufficiently potent and specific to give unequivocal type-specific reactions with all the serotypes. متن کاملApplication of the immunofluorescent technique in testing the purity of Sendai virus.
Various attempts have been made in this laboratory to eliminate the host components surrounding Sendai virus particles. Procedures such as fluorocarbon treatment, sonication and methanol precipitation resulted in the loss of infectious titer of the test materials.
